Understanding the PCAT

The Pharmacy College Admission Test (PCAT) is not just an exam; it’s a milestone on the road to a fulfilling career in pharmacy. This standardized exam is the gateway to pharmacy programs across the nation and is designed to evaluate the academic ability and scientific knowledge of prospective pharmacy students.

What is the PCAT, and Why Does it Matter?

The PCAT is a comprehensive and rigorous test that assesses an applicant’s capabilities across several core areas of knowledge integral for the study and the practice of pharmacy. Administered by Pearson VUE for the American Association of Colleges of Pharmacy (AACP), the exam serves as one of the criteria for admission into pharmacy degree programs.

The Structure of the PCAT

At its core, the PCAT is divided into several sections, each aimed at evaluating different skill sets:

  1. Biological Processes: Measuring knowledge in biology, microbiology, and human anatomy.
  2. Chemical Processes: Assessing understanding of general chemistry, organic chemistry, and basic biochemistry processes.
  3. Critical Reading: Determining ability to comprehend, analyze, and evaluate reading passages on a range of subjects.
  4. Quantitative Reasoning: Testing the mathematical skills and abilities required for the pharmaceutical field.
  5. Writing: Evaluating the ability to convey complex ideas in a coherent, persuasive manner in writing.

Each of these areas is critical to your future success, both in your education and your career as a pharmacist.

Exam Content Overview

Understanding the content on the PCAT is essential for effective study and preparation. Let’s explore what you’ll encounter in each section of the exam and thus, what you will practice with the official Prep Tests.

Biological Processes

Diving into life sciences, this section evaluates knowledge in general biology, human anatomy and physiology, genetics, and microbiology. Questions will involve both stand-alone knowledge and the application of scientific processes.

Chemical Processes

Chemistry at a glance, you’ll be challenged on organic chemistry, general chemistry, and basic biochemistry. From reaction mechanisms to molecular structures, you need to be ready to put your knowledge into practice.

Critical Reading

Developing informed insights, this section features passages from various disciplines, requiring you to understand, analyze, and draw conclusions. Sharp critical thinking skills are a must here.

Quantitative Reasoning

Solving the puzzles of pharmaceuticals, you’ll face math skills, including algebra, probability, statistics, precalculus, and calculus. These questions are not just about rote calculations, they test how well you can apply these skills to real-world problems.

Writing

Expressing coherent thoughts, with an essay task, you’ll need to provide a solution to a problem or argue for a specific point of view in a clear and persuasive manner. This section simulates the type of thinking and communication essential in the pharmacy field.

Each of these sections is mirrored in the practice exams, enabling you to experience a comprehensive look at what is expected of your real test performance.

Analyzing Practice Exam Results

When taking the official PCAT practice exam, the goal should extend beyond just answering questions. The subsequent step, interpreting the results, is an equally critical part of your path to a great PCAT score.

Understanding Your Score Report

After you’ve completed a practice exam, you’ll receive a score report. This isn’t just about the score; it is a comprehensive breakdown of your performance across all sections. Here’s how to decode it:

  • Percentile Ranks: Your percentile rank compares your performance with that of other test takers. It is not merely the percentage of questions you got right.
  • Subtest Scores: Each subtest score highlights your command over different sections of the PCAT. Pay attention to the scores relative to each other to identify which areas need more work.

Identifying Areas for Improvement

  • Trend Analysis: Look for patterns in the questions you missed. Are they primarily from one area, or are your mistakes spread out?
  • Difficulty Levels: Review how you fare against more challenging questions, as these often make a significant difference in higher percentile ranks.

Adjusting Your Study Plan

Based on your practice exam insights, take a strategic approach to adjust your study plan:

  1. Allocate more time to sections where you scored lower.
  2. Review concepts linked to frequently missed question types.
  3. Practice similar questions to those that caused difficulties.
